The book is a detailed account of the archaeological project to recover King Henry VIII's flagship which sank in 1545 whilst attempting to take action against an assembled French fleet in the solent.
The book describes the extensive work by archaeologists led by Margaret rule,( who in fact learnt to dive in order to oversee the excavation,) divers and volunteers to find,excavate and ultimately raise the ship from the solent seabed in 1982. The forward by Prince Charles highlights the incredible human endeavor and the scientific and historical insights gained from the project.
